We were invited to be in our first ever barn sale at The Milky Way Farms in Pulaski, Tn. It was Bella Rustica. It was a vintage market place. To be a vendor you had to have at least 90% of your items to be vintage or repurposed items. Now, that’s my kind of show!!  Be sure and check out their site also!

This farm was wonderful with lots of old barns and a beautiful manor house (that I now wish I would have checked out more) and a wonderful old stone barn where the show was held! This farm was started by the Mars family, as in the Milky Way/Mars candy bar people. I had no idea this beautiful place was nearby! You should check them out! Click the link to see the farm.
